Disulfur monoxide or sulfur suboxide is an inorganic compound with the formula S 2 O, one of the lower sulfur oxides. It is a colourless gas and condenses to give a roughly dark red coloured solid that is unstable at room temperature. S 2O occurs rarely in natural atmospheres, but can be made by a variety of laboratory procedures.

Structure Disulfur dioxide adopts a cis planar structure with C2v symmetry. The S−O bond length is 145.8 pm, shorter than in sulfur monoxide. The S−S bond length is 202.45 pm and the O−S−S angle is 112.7°. S 2 O 2 has a dipole moment of 3.17 D. [4] It is an asymmetric top molecule. [1] [5] Formation
